Description
A delightful dessert that brings the taste of the tropics right to your kitchen, combining moist cake and sweet pineapple.
Ingredients
Scale
- 1 tsp salt
- 1 tsp baking powder
- 1 and 1/2 cups all-purpose flour
- 1/2 cup unsalted butter, softened
- 1 cup white sugar
- 2 large eggs
- 1 tsp vanilla extract
- 1/2 cup sour cream
- 1 cup crushed pineapple, well-drained
- 1/2 cup icing sugar
- 2 tbsp pineapple juice
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C).
- Grease and flour a 9-inch round cake pan.
- In a medium bowl, whisk together the flour, baking powder, and salt.
- In a large bowl, cream the softened butter with the granulated sugar until light and fluffy.
- Beat in the eggs, one at a time, followed by the vanilla extract.
- Gently fold in the sour cream.
- Gradually add the dry ingredients into the wet mixture, mixing gently.
- Carefully fold in the drained crushed pineapple.
- Pour the batter into the prepared pan and spread evenly.
- Bake for 30-35 minutes or until a toothpick inserted comes out clean.
- While the cake bakes, whisk together the powdered sugar and pineapple juice until smooth.
- Allow the cake to cool before glazing and enjoy!
Notes
Make sure the crushed pineapple is well-drained to avoid a soggy cake. For an extra touch, add fresh pineapple slices or toasted coconut on top for decoration.
